You can now enjoy the sights and sounds of Canada's Wonderland.
The amusement park opened its gates today for the first time in about two years.
The attraction closed down for the season in December 2019, and remained closed due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
Canada's Wonderland has reopened with a 25 percent capacity limit, and all attendees must reserve their spot in advance.
You'll need to wear a mask on all rides, in all indoor spaces, and in other areas where physical distancing can't be maintained.
